Being high on Trip Advisor ranking and charging MORE than a five star city hotel, Bellevue set expectations. Unfortunately, none were met. This is a very clean, but very tired establishment lacking any character or charm. It is a plain suburban house, not updated since being built some 20 years ago. The walls are paper thin, we heard the man in the next room snoring and breakfast conversations woke us up. The bathrooms are dated, the furniture is plain and cheap and old as is the bed linen and towels. The sheets were so thin we worried we might tear them. The English owners are pleasant and polite, but there is no excuse for charging such a premium rate and offering nothing in return. When we asked about Internet, we were told to go to the local library. This is plain stingy and rude as our devices detected their wifi. The rooms were too small for even a chair and the TV is the smallest screen size possible. Our tip is to stay in Adelaide and day trip to McLaren Vale as it is a very short drive, or stay at one of the wineries like The Chapel.
Overall, this is a clean 2 star establisment that charges 5 star rates.
